Should we trade Sessions?

As of late, I've heard several rumors about the availability of Cavs backup point guard Ramon Sessions. Many of the rumors center around the Los Angeles Lakers. The Lakers are in dire need of a capable point guard and Ramon would fill that vacancy perfect, so it makes sense that the Lakers are interested. But what do they have to offer the Cavs? The Cavs are a rebuilding team so they want young talent and draft picks. As it is now, L.A has 2 first round draft picks in the 2012 Draft which should be very appealing to the Cavs. If I was Chris Grant, G.M of the Cavaliers, I would only trade Sessions for those 2 first round draft choices as the Lakers really have nothing else to offer. The only way I trade Sessions, who is a great player on this Cavs team and runs the team's second offense, is if the Cavs receive two draft choices in return.
